* | netfilter: xtables: make ip_tables reentrantJan Engelhardt2010-04-191-0/+7
| |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| Currently, the table traverser stores return addresses in the ruleset itself (struct ip6t_entry->comefrom). This has a well-known drawback: the jumpstack is overwritten on reentry, making it necessary for targets to return absolute verdicts. Also, the ruleset (which might be heavy memory-wise) needs to be replicated for each CPU that can possibly invoke ip6t_do_table. This patch decouples the jumpstack from struct ip6t_entry and instead puts it into xt_table_info. Not being restricted by 'comefrom' anymore, we can set up a stack as needed. By default, there is room allocated for two entries into the traverser. arp_tables is not touched though, because there is just one/two modules and further patches seek to collapse the table traverser anyhow. * | netfilter: xt_recent: add an entry reaperTim Gardner2010-03-171-0/+4
| | | | | | | | | | | | | | | | | | | | | | | | | | | | | | One of the problems with the way xt_recent is implemented is that there is no efficient way to remove expired entries. Of course, one can write a rule '-m recent --remove', but you have to know beforehand which entry to delete. This commit adds reaper logic which checks the head of the LRU list when a rule is invoked that has a '--seconds' value and XT_RECENT_REAP set. If an entry ceases to accumulate time stamps, then it will eventually bubble to the top of the LRU list where it is then reaped. * netfilter: CONFIG_COMPAT: allow delta to exceed 32767Florian Westphal2010-02-151-1/+1
| | | | | | | | | | | | | | | | with 32 bit userland and 64 bit kernels, it is unlikely but possible that insertion of new rules fails even tough there are only about 2000 iptables rules. This happens because the compat delta is using a short int. Easily reproducible via "iptables -m limit" ; after about 2050 rules inserting new ones fails with -ELOOP. Note that compat_delta included 2 bytes of padding on x86_64, so structure size remains the same. Signed-off-by: Florian Westphal <fw@strlen.de> Signed-off-by: Patrick McHardy <kaber@trash.net>

* netfilter: nf_conntrack_sip: add TCP supportPatrick McHardy2010-02-111-1/+2
| | | | | | | | | | Add TCP support, which is mandated by RFC3261 for all SIP elements. SIP over TCP is similar to UDP, except that messages are delimited by Content-Length: headers and multiple messages may appear in one packet. Signed-off-by: Patrick McHardy <kaber@trash.net>

| * netfilter: nf_ct_tcp: improve out-of-sync situation in TCP trackingPablo Neira Ayuso2009-11-231-0/+3
| |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| Without this patch, if we receive a SYN packet from the client while the firewall is out-of-sync, we let it go through. Then, if we see the SYN/ACK reply coming from the server, we destroy the conntrack entry and drop the packet to trigger a new retransmission. Then, the retransmision from the client is used to start a new clean session. This patch improves the current handling. Basically, if we see an unexpected SYN packet, we annotate the TCP options. Then, if we see the reply SYN/ACK, this means that the firewall was indeed out-of-sync. Therefore, we set a clean new session from the existing entry based on the annotated values. This patch adds two new 8-bits fields that fit in a 16-bits gap of the ip_ct_tcp structure. This patch is particularly useful for conntrackd since the asynchronous nature of the state-synchronization allows to have backup nodes that are not perfect copies of the master. This helps to improve the recovery under some worst-case scenarios.
